ON-VEHICLE MAINTENANCE

CLUTCH PEDAL

Inspection and Adjustment

INFOID:0000000001731683

INSPECTION

1.

Make sure that clevis pin (1) floats freely in the bore of clutch
pedal. It should not be bound by clevis or clutch pedal.

a.

If clevis pin is not free, make sure that ASCD clutch switch (2) is
not applying pressure to clutch pedal causing clevis pin to bind.
To adjust, loosen lock nut (3) and turn ASCD clutch switch.

b.

Tighten lock nut. Refer to 

CL-7, "Exploded View"

.

c.

Make sure that clevis pin floats in the bore of clutch pedal. It
should not be bound by clutch pedal.

d.

If clevis pin is still not free, remove clevis pin and check for
deformation or damage. Replace clevis pin if necessary. Leave
clevis pin removed for step 2.

2.

Check clutch pedal stroke for free range of movement.

a.

With clevis pin removed, manually move clutch pedal up and down to determine if it moves freely.

b.

If any sticking is found, replace related parts (bushing, clutch pedal assembly, etc.). Reassemble clutch
pedal and again make sure that clevis pin floats freely in the bore of clutch pedal.

3.

Check clutch hydraulic and system components (clutch master cylinder, CSC, etc.) for sticking or binding.

a.

If any sticking or binding is found, repair or replace related parts as necessary.

b.

If hydraulic system repair was necessary, bleed the clutch hydraulic system. Refer to 

CL-6, "Air Bleeding

Procedure"

.

CLUTCH FLUID

CLUTCH FLUID

Inspection

INFOID:0000000001731684

CLUTCH FLUID LEVEL

• Check that the fluid level in the reservoir tank is within the specified

range (MAX – MIN lines).

• Visually check for any clutch fluid leakage around the reservoir

tank.

• Check the clutch system for any leakage if the fluid level is

extremely low (lower than MIN).

Air Bleeding Procedure

INFOID:0000000001731685

CAUTION:

• Monitor clutch fluid level in reservoir tank to make sure it does not empty.
• Keep painted surface on the body or other parts free of clutch fluid. If it spills, wipe up immediately

and wash the affected area with water.

NOTE:
Do not use a vacuum assist or any other type of power bleeder on this system. Use of vacuum assist or power
bleeder will not purge all the air from the system.
1.

Fill master cylinder reservoir tank with new clutch fluid.

2.

Connect a transparent vinyl hose to air bleeder valve.

3.

Depress clutch pedal slowly and fully several times at an interval
of 2 to 3 seconds and hold it.

4.

With clutch pedal depressed, open air bleeder valve to release
air. 

5.

Close air bleeder valve.

6.

Release clutch pedal and wait for 5 seconds.

7.

Repeat steps 3 to 6 until no bubbles can be observed in clutch
fluid.

8.

Tighten air bleeder valve to the specified torque. Refer to 

CL-15,

"Exploded View"

.

ON-VEHICLE REPAIR

CLUTCH PEDAL

Exploded View

INFOID:0000000001731686

Removal and Installation

INFOID:0000000001731687

REMOVAL

1.

Remove kicking plate inner and dash side finisher. Refer to 

INT-14, "Removal and Installation"

.

2.

Remove instrument driver lower panel. Refer to 

IP-12, "Removal and Installation"

.

3.

Remove bracket (1) and harness bracket (2).

4.

Disconnect ASCD clutch switch and clutch interlock switch har-
ness connectors and then disconnect clip of harness from clutch
pedal assembly.

5.

Remove snap pin and clevis pin.

6.

Remove clutch pedal assembly.
